Subject: Key-card stock for the Lornbeck site opening

Dear Dispatch Desk,

Ahead of Monday's opening of the Lornbeck facility, we are sending two sealed boxes of blank key-card stock from the main warehouse. Each box is shrink-wrapped, numbered, and recorded against the stock ledger, so please do not break the seals at any point. The boxes must travel on a single van and be signed for on arrival. The courier hand-over should follow this instruction:

handover note for bajog-tawig: the lamion quenael courier leaves the wendor ledger at gate 1289 under passcode 760784

CI note for support. Vexahost health checks behind the Larkspur load balancer flapped between 03:10 and 03:42. Cause: the check endpoint hit the warm-up path on every new pod, timing out at 2s. Mitigation: timeout raised to 5s, warm-up moved to a pre-start hook. No customer impact confirmed; a few retried requests only. Do not restart nodes manually if this recurs — escalate instead. Full logs are attached to the incident channel. Reference the failing run with the token below.

pipeline stamp: htk31_f769b577b3028a4e9958e5bb8d1259a

## Releases

Welcome aboard! GateTally is the turnstile counter running at Harrowfield Arena, and we cut releases every other Friday. Build the firmware bundle with `make release`, then tag it `gt-vX.Y`. The ops crew at Bramwick Stadium Systems flashes units overnight, so don't push after 4pm their time. Each bundle has to be signed before the updater will touch it — unsigned builds get rejected at the gate, pun intended. Use the team signing key below for all release artifacts.

signing key of bagap-yawep = bky13_TbfT6ZMUoGJo2

Q3 Planning Note — For Incoming Director

Effective immediately, hiring in the Meridex Tools division is frozen. All open requisitions are pulled; backfills require VP sign-off. Attrition will not be replaced through Q4. Rationale: margin compression on the Brightline product and slower enterprise renewals out of the Calverton office. Contractors already under agreement may finish their terms. Revisit at January planning. Questions to Oren Delmach, interim ops lead. The confidential rationale and next steps follow below.

board note of kageg-bahof: The renewal with Holwynax Holdings closes at $2 million a year, 5 percent below the last contract. Project Ulaath slips by two quarters because of the supplier delay.